One of the key aspects of biopharma resources is their role in drug discovery and development. The process of bringing a new drug to market is complex and requires a multitude of resources to be successful. Biopharma companies rely on a variety of tools and technologies to identify potential drug targets, screen for drug candidates, and optimize lead compounds for further development. These resources include high-throughput screening platforms, animal models, computational modeling software, and more.

In addition to drug discovery, biopharma resources are also vital in the development and manufacturing of pharmaceutical products. Once a drug candidate has been identified, it must undergo rigorous testing to ensure its safety and efficacy. Biopharma companies utilize a number of resources such as cell culture systems, analytical equipment, and quality control processes to assess the properties of the drug and determine the best formulation for administration.

Furthermore, biopharma resources are crucial in the production of biopharmaceuticals, which are drugs derived from living organisms such as cells or proteins. These complex molecules require specialized manufacturing techniques and equipment to produce them at large scale. Biopharma companies invest in bioreactors, purification systems, and other resources to manufacture biopharmaceuticals efficiently and ensure their consistent quality.

Moreover, biopharma resources play a key role in personalized medicine, which aims to customize medical treatments for individual patients based on their genetic makeup and other factors. Advances in genomics and other technologies have made it possible to tailor therapies to specific patient populations, leading to more effective and targeted treatments. Biopharma companies use a variety of resources such as biomarkers, genetic testing platforms, and data analytics tools to identify optimal treatment strategies for patients.
